In 1544, Emma Yates entered the world in Horton, Wiltshire, England, born to Sir Thomas Yates Yeates Lord Of Berkshire And Frances Yates White Whyte. Emma Yates married John Thomas Stephens Stevens Rector Of Ingelsham Xii, and had children including Robert Stephens Stevens. Emma Yates passed away in 1612 in Preston (near Cirencester), Gloucestershire, England.
